The core difference
Carrier411 has been a carrier-monitoring staple since around 2005. Its job is to help freight brokers and shippers qualify carriers and get alerted when a registered carrier’s safety rating, insurance, or authority changes. That is genuinely useful — for vetting carriers you haul with.
XDate Alert solves a different problem. It is built for the insurance agent: every pending FMCSA insurance cancellation in your states, delivered daily with carrier phone numbers and the exact date coverage ends, so you can call a carrier the day its insurer files to walk away.
When Carrier411 may be the better choice
If you are a freight broker or shipper vetting carriers for safety and authority before you tender a load, Carrier411 is purpose-built for that and XDate Alert is not — we are not a broker-vetting tool. If your job is selling trucking insurance and finding carriers whose coverage is ending, XDate Alert is the focused tool.

Frequently asked questions
Is XDate Alert a Carrier411 alternative?
They overlap on FMCSA data but do different jobs. Carrier411 is a carrier-vetting and monitoring service for freight brokers and shippers. XDate Alert is built for trucking insurance agents to find carriers with pending insurance cancellations and sell them coverage.
Does Carrier411 show confirmed insurance cancellations?
Carrier411 monitors registered carriers and sends alerts when safety, insurance, or authority status changes. It is a monitoring tool, not a daily prospecting feed of upcoming cancellations. XDate Alert delivers every pending cancellation in your states as a daily list.
Is XDate Alert cheaper than Carrier411?
Carrier411's publicly listed price is around $99/month. XDate Alert is $99 (single state), $179 (3 states), or $249 (nationwide) per month. Pricing may change — check each site for current figures.
